Formulation and Physical Characteristics of Effervescent Granules from Sunkist Peels Ethanol Extract Maya Sari Mutia; Stephanie Raibalaki; Siti Rahma; Anita Zahra; Ali Napiah Nasution; Widya Yanti Sihotang

Abstract

Citrus fruit has a sweet taste and attractive shape, which is also enriched various health benefits. Some studies have been performed to investigate the pharmacology effects from the Sunkist peel extract. However, none of this study was look for the development of pharmaceutical products. Hence this study was performed to investigate the pharmaceutical formulation as an effervescent granule from Sunkist peel extract. This study was an experimental study to investigate the optimum formulation that was made by wet granulation methods. There were three formulation of Sunkist peel extract effervescent granule that were combination of organic acids (citric acid and tartaric acid), sodium bicarbonate as base compound, and some sweetener including aspartame, lactose, and mannitol. After that, the formulation was evaluated the physical properties including organoleptic, flow rate, dissolution time, foam height, pH, and angle of repose. The result of this study showed that these three formulations of Sunkist Peel extract effervescent granule showed significant different in almost all of physical properties including: flow rate (P-Value = 0.027), dissolution time (P-Value less than 0.05), foam height (P-Value = 0.004), and angle of repose (P-Value: 0.043), except the degree of acidity or pH (P-Value = 0.128). Third formulation (F3) reveals the best physical properties as a Sunkist peel extract effervescent granule. Overall, it can be concluded that the third and second formulation fulfils a well physical properties of effervescent granule for Sunkist peel extract.
